Tricks To Make Your Toddler Brush


Be The Role Model

For your child to understand the importance of brushing, you need to make sure you flash a healthy smile. So, make sure you are an ideal role model for your child. So, if you want your child to follow healthy hygiene habits, you should also work towards it.

Brushing Made Fun

One of the trick for making your child brush is to make it a fun activity. The more it becomes an ordeal the less interested they are in that activity. You can run their favorite music while they are brushing. You can even make them shake their hips to the favourite song while brushing. When you ask them to do something so interesting, you will have them doing the task happily. TRY THIS - Best ways to clean your teeth...

Brush & Paste
The brush and paste play an important role in getting your kids interested in some hygiene habits. You would need to get a brush that appears funky and cool. It should definitely attract your kids attention. So, when you call your child to brush, hold up that lovely brush. Attracted, he would definitely insist on brushing. Reward Your Child
When your child is brushing, it is a humongous task. So, make sure you reward your child with some encouraging words or anything that he/she loves when they come out brushing. Every once in a while such rewards would encourage your kids to keep brushing.

Keep their Confidence Boosted
Here's another tip for making your toddler brush his teeth: the first time around, brush your child’s teeth for him/her. Ask them to check if you have done a good job. This will boost their confidence when you ask them to check on your work. This will get them started with brushing and they will put in extra efforts to keep their teeth clean. Remember, it’s not about making things difficult; it is all about making it enjoyable.
